OVERVIEW: The Relationship Manager role in Portfolio Management provides comprehensive investment advice and management for Glenmede’s private clients and serves as Relationship Manager on designated relationships. This position works closely with an experienced team of wealth advisory and planning colleagues to provide integrated wealth management solutions that meet varied, complex private client needs. This position requires working knowledge of additional practice areas such as financial and estate planning, fiduciary investment and administration, philanthropic advisory, business development and other relevant disciplines.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as Relationship Manager on designated client relationships, being accountable for coordinating investments, financial planning, administration and other wealth management advice and solutions.
  • Adopt a ‘leader among peers’ management approach in fulfilling Relationship Management responsibilities, and coordinate with external advisors as appropriate.
  • Work closely with other professionals on the team to ensure that clients benefit from our best thinking across relevant wealth management practice areas. Identify financial and non-financial considerations to integrate into the overall investment plan.
  • Develop, implement and proactively communicate and manage investment plans on behalf of clients, consistent with Glenmede’s best thinking and practices.
  • Formulate client investment objectives, create Investment Policy Statements, develop and implement an asset allocation that enables the client to achieve stated objectives, and monitor overall portfolio construction to ensure alignment with client’s wealth objectives.
  • Prepare and maintain client information in accordance with documentation retention practices and procedures utilizing the client relationship management (CRM) system and all other required technology platforms.
  • Become proficient with Glenmede’s investment solutions, including Separately Managed Accounts, Private Equity, hedge funds and other specialized strategies.
  • Participate in Investment Policy Committee meetings, Manager Research meetings, and other venues to maintain investment knowledge and contribute to firm thinking.
  • Participate in new business development process, attend Glenmede-sponsored events, cultivate COI’s, and partner with Business Development Officers to create, present and execute investment proposals tailored to meet client objectives.
